Dene Academy is seeking to appoint a passionate and motivated practitioner who can deliver high quality learning across all areas of the English curriculum. We are a high achieving school with an excellent climate for learning. Our students progress exceptionally well and we take pride in our strong values of academic achievement, equality of experience and respect for all. You are required to be an excellent practitioner with a past record of high performance linked to students' learning, standards and progress. You must also have a belief in the ability of all students within the school to achieve their full potential. Moreover, you will need to demonstrate that you can inspire both staff and students.
Responsibilities:
- To work in partnership with teachers and other professionals to provide effective support for learning activities, tailoring support to the needs of the students if necessary.
- To support planning and delivery of the curriculum for students.
- To offer students varied and purposeful extended day activities in and out of school.
- To contribute to the planning, preparation, maintenance and evaluation of learning activities and environment, identify areas of improvement and new developments as necessary.
- To promote and assist with the development of core literacy and numeracy skills.
- To monitor, assess, report and maintain records of students and their performance.
- To work with small groups of students and individuals both within the classroom and during intervention sessions.
- To provide appropriate support and care for students throughout the day, including break and lunchtime monitoring and pre-post academy activities as necessary.
- To attend meetings about students as required.
- To invigilate internal and external tests and examinations under formal conditions.
- To accompany and supervise students on trips and visits as appropriate.
- To liaise with parents/carers and outside agencies as appropriate.
- Follow Academy policy regarding care, support and supervision of students.
